What Hockey Cards Are Most Popular?

In Portage, popular cards include those of Wayne Gretzky, Mario Lemieux, and contemporary rookies such as Connor McDavid and Auston Matthews. Sidney Crosby and Alex Ovechkin cards also see consistent collector interest, particularly those bearing authentic autographs or grading credentials.

Collectors favor rookie cards, autograph cards, vintage specimens, and graded slabs from PSA, BGS, SGC, and CGC. Sealed hobby boxes attract buyers hoping to uncover rare parallels or memorabilia inserts from brands like Upper Deck and The Cup.

How Hockey Card Values Are Determined

Condition remains paramount, assessed through centering, corners, edges, and surface quality, often verified by professional grading. Rarity and player legacy, including Hall of Fame induction, amplify value along with authenticated autographs and limited serial numbering. Market demand and recent sales trends further define importance and price.

Popular Hockey Card Products Collectors Look For in Portage

Upper Deck Series 1 and Series 2 rookie cards, especially featuring Young Guns, are highly sought. Premium products like The Cup and SP Authentic provide top-tier autograph and memorabilia pieces. O-Pee-Chee and Artifacts appeal to collectors with nostalgic designs, while sealed hobby boxes and graded slabs remain foundational to Portage collections.
